Description

The Leaders of Tomorrow start here! Master e-commerce, manage risk, and build the future.

The Business Management programme responds to the growing market demand for highly qualified managers capable of operating effectively in the world of digital customer relationships, professional auditing, and online brand positioning strategies. Graduates, equipped with specialist knowledge of operational and financial risk management, will be prepared to help organizations ensure security, resilience, and sustainable growth.

During your studies:

  • you will learn to design, manage, and optimize e-commerce systems and professional online marketing campaigns,
  • you will acquire the skills to assess, quantify, and monitor operational and financial risk within an organization,
  • you will become familiar with IT tools supporting decision-making processes and customer relationship management (CRM),
  • you will learn the principles of Design Thinking,
  • you will gain the ability to manage projects and quality according to international standards,
  • you will acquire knowledge of search engine optimization (SEO), web analytics, and customer relationship building,
  • you will learn to interpret legal regulations related to e-commerce, intellectual property protection, and digital security,
  • you will develop competencies in human resource management, crisis psychology, and negotiation techniques,
  • you will prepare to conduct professional financial and HR audits and develop business plans.

Selected courses:

Business Psychology and Sociology, Business Leadership, Communication and Negotiation, Business Strategy Simulations, ERP and CRM Systems in Business Management, Design Thinking, Legal Aspects of E-commerce, Operational and Financial Risk Management.


Career opportunities:

After graduation, you may pursue a career as a:

  • E-commerce Manager / E-commerce Specialist – managing online sales platforms and a company's digital strategy,
  • Risk Manager – analysing and controlling market, credit, and insurance risks,
  • SEO Specialist / E-commerce Analyst – optimizing brand visibility and the effectiveness of online marketing campaigns,
  • Business Consultant – supporting companies in implementing growth strategies, innovation, and digital transformation,
  • CRM and Public Relations Specialist – building long-term relationships with business partners and managing corporate reputation,
  • Entrepreneur – running your own business, including technology-based startups.

Required Documents:

  1. secondary school certificate containing a transcript of marks – in the original language and sworn translation into English or Polish
  2. Legalization/Apostille of the originally issued diploma and transcript of marks
  3. valid passport (pages with photo and personal data)
  4. visa (if required and obtained)
  5. language confirmation (not necessary for citizens of English-speaking countries). More info here
  6. health insurance (before arrival at KUT)

Fees:

  • Tuition fee for course in English = €1,400 per semester
  • Tuition fee for course in Polish = €600 per semester
  • Application fee = €24 (€20 if the math exam is not required)
  • Application fee for Architecture = €35
